Bill Summary
Cathedral Rock and Horse Heaven Wilderness Act of 2010 - Designates specified Bureau of Land Management (BLM) land in Oregon, to be known as the Cathedral Rock Wilderness and the Horse Heaven Wilderness, as wilderness and as components of the National Wilderness Preservation System. Sets forth requirements for the administration of the wilderness areas, including with respect to the incorporation of acquired land and interests, domestic...
(Source: Library of Congress)
